About Sofia Strid
Sofia Strid is an Associate Professor of Gender Studies and affiliated researcher at the Centre for Feminist Social Studies at Örebro University.
Since 2022, Sofia Strid is Senior Lecturer in Sociology, Director of Doctoral Studies and, since 2024, Deputy Head of the Department of Sociology and Work Science at the University of Gothenburg. Sofia Strid is also a visiting researcher at Oxford Brookes University, UK and lecturer by invitation at the University of Belgrade.
Sofia Strid has been a Senior Lecturer, researcher and PhD supervisor in Gender studies, Media and Communication, Law, Policy studies, Social Work, Sociology, Political Science and Women's Studies in Austria, Belgium, Sweden, and the UK. Sofia's research focuses on violence as a system, resistance to feminism, and social, economic and ecological sustainability. She leads a number of EU projects in these research areas.
